Sherlock Contextual Classification
Prediction: Supernova
The transient is possibly associated with NGC4342; an r=11.97 mag galaxy found in the NED-D/DESI/LASR catalogues. Its located 14.36" N, 6.19" W (1.3 Kpc) from the galaxy centre. A host distance of 16.8 Mpc(z=0.003) implies a m - M = 31.13.
